COMMUNITY<br />

2012 – <strong>2013</strong> PROFILE<br />

<strong>Robbinsville</strong> <strong>High</strong> <strong>School</strong> is located in <strong>Robbinsville</strong> Township, New Jersey, ten miles east<br />

of the state capital. Adjacent to the research and development corridor between Rutgers<br />

and Princeton Universities, the community is dynamic, growing, and comprised mainly<br />

of a well educated middle and upper class population. With a high value on education, a<br />

high percentage of <strong>Robbinsville</strong> parents are corporate leaders, financial executives,<br />

doctors, lawyers, engineers, and other professionals.<br />

SCHOOL<br />

Despite being a young high school having graduated only five classes, <strong>Robbinsville</strong> <strong>High</strong><br />

<strong>School</strong> has distinguished itself by equipping its students to gain entrance to the nation’s<br />

most prestigious colleges and universities. By following a rigorous academic curriculum<br />

and participating in a wide array of co- and extra- curricular experiences, RHS students<br />

are able to pursue challenging and meaningful experiences designed to equip and<br />

empower them as well-rounded learners.<br />

ACCREDITATION <strong>Robbinsville</strong> <strong>High</strong> <strong>School</strong> is accredited by the New Jersey Department of Education. It is<br />

also accredited by the Middle States Association (MSA).<br />

MISSION<br />

CURRICULUM<br />

The mission of <strong>Robbinsville</strong> <strong>High</strong> <strong>School</strong> is to engage students in an academically<br />

challenging and technologically advanced learning environment that fosters the<br />

development of young adults as responsible, respectful, and innovative contributors to a<br />

global society.<br />

The college preparatory curriculum is designed to challenge students’ academic potential<br />

while addressing the entrance requirements of competitive colleges. The program<br />

contains a full complement of courses including advanced placement courses in most<br />

disciplines. In addition to state and local mandated courses, <strong>Robbinsville</strong> <strong>High</strong> <strong>School</strong><br />

offers an abundance of interesting and meaningful electives – something for everyone<br />

whether it is the arts, technology, engineering, business, or a particular career path.

Important Information:<br />

-AP courses are offered to students in grades 11 and grades 12.<br />

-Students who are enrolled in an honors course may enroll in a subsequent honors course if they earn a final grade of a B- or better in the current course.<br />

-Students who are enrolled in a college prep course may enroll in a subsequent honors or AP course in that subject area if they earn a final grade of A- or better.<br />

-RHS instituted a policy in September 2008 that students are limited to taking only 3 AP courses each year.<br />

Disclosure Policy- <strong>Robbinsville</strong> <strong>High</strong> <strong>School</strong>’s policy is to only disclose information regarding the individual student’s academic transcript.
